Mykola Palazhchenko
curator, producer

Since 1993, he has been actively involved in the artistic life of the city, including at the Yakimanka Contemporary Art Center, Spider & Mouse Gallery, and at the Institute of Contemporary Art (hereinafter: Institute of Contemporary Art).

1999-2001- was a curator of the festival programs: The Unofficial Capital, 21st Century Cultural Heroes.

In 2002, jointly with several collectors he founded the Contemporary Art Collectors Club, a non-profit association aimed at collecting and promoting contemporary art.

Since 2004, at the invitation of the shareholders of the former Mosvinokombinat, he participated in the development of the concept and creation of the Art Center "Winery" in the complex of buildings of the former brewery which has become the first large public art cluster in Moscow.

From 2005 to 2007 he was the Art Director of the Winery. In 2007 he has become a member of the Board of the Winery Foundation.

In 2006, together with the publisher and philanthropist Alexander Pogorelsky, he has organized the Society for Supporting Contemporary Art "Metafuturism" and initiated the Contemporary Art Festival in the city of Shargorod (Ukraine).

In 2007, an architectural workshop was held in Shargorod under the supervision of Mykola Palazhchenko, with the participation of over 40 young architects.

In 2008-2010 he participated in the creation of the Perm Museum of Contemporary Art (PERMM).

In 2010, he initiated the creation of a cluster of art workshops in the legendary Narkomfin house.

In 2012 he established the Faculty of Art Management and Gallery Business within the RMA Business School.

Since 2014 he has represented Art Basel in the Baltic States and the CIS.
